Output 0ec7d50887caba84c627600b5efd8794cb7754c9169dc44e76f11f7b39e8c395:0

value
360468929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afcc09fa70364d674423ba7688b585b60035edf2 OP_EQUAL
address
3HiYbzREs4xiV44JzKUPrCcsa3GuqoUV4J
transaction
0ec7d50887caba84c627600b5efd8794cb7754c9169dc44e76f11f7b39e8c395
confirmations
309586
spent
true